Faculty Fellowships

The Pembroke Center's Faculty Research Fellowships support the participation of Brown faculty members in the Pembroke Seminar, an interdisciplinary research seminar that meets weekly throughout the academic year. Participants include Pembroke Center Postdoctoral Fellows, Brown faculty, visiting faculty, faculty affiliates, and graduate and undergraduate fellows. In 2008-2009, the seminar focuses on "Visions of Nature: Constructing the Cultural Other " (see full description). Senior Faculty Fellow and Associate Professor of Art Leslie Bostrom leads the seminar. It meets on Wednesdays from 10:00 a.m. to 12:30 pm.

Applications for the Upcoming Seminar

Funds will be made available, on a per-course replacement basis, to enable faculty members to receive release time from one course to participate in the 2009-2010 seminar. The seminar will be under the direction of Senior Faculty Fellow and Professor of Anthropology Kay Warren. The seminar will meet on Wednesdays from 10:00 a.m. to 12:30 p.m. (see full description, coming soon )

All campus-based full-time faculty members are encouraged to apply. An application should include a current curriculum vitae and a project proposal (1000 words) that describes the applicant's research. Faculty participants should have an active interest in the seminar's topic, but the research project may be in any related field and need not directly address the topic.

The deadline for application is December 12, 2008.
